posted on 2023-06-09, 01:47 authored by Benedict AllbrookeBenedict Allbrooke, Lily AsquithLily Asquith, Alessandro CerriAlessandro Cerri, Carlos Chavez Barajas, Antonella De SantoAntonella De Santo, Tina Potter, Fabrizio SalvatoreFabrizio Salvatore, Itzebelt Santoyo Castillo, Kerim Suruliz, Mark SuttonMark Sutton, Iacopo Vivarelli, et al The ATLAS CollaborationA search for evidence of physics beyond the Standard Model in final states with multiple high-transverse-momentum jets is performed using 20.3 fb-1 of proton-proton collision data at vs=8 TeV recorded by the ATLAS detector at the LHC. No significant excess of events beyond Standard Model expectations is observed, and upper limits on the visible cross sections for non-Standard Model production of multi-jet final states are set. A wide variety of models for black hole and string ball production and decay are considered, and the upper limit on the cross section times acceptance is as low as 0.16 fb at the 95% confidence level. For these models, excluded regions are also given as function of the main model parameters.
